Oil & gas is the dominating end-use industry in the carbon capture, utilization, and storage market. The use of CCUS in natural gas processing is one of the major drivers of the CCUS market. Various natural gas processing CCUS projects in MEA, North America, and Europe is key support or the high market size in the oil & gas industry. Increasing usage of EOR in the oil & gas industry is also driving the growth of oil & gas industry in the carbon capture, utilization, and storage market.

In 2019, there were more than 24 million tons of CO2 that was captured, stored, and utilized from the oil & gas industry, and the majority of it was extracted from natural gas processing plants. As per the EIA, natural gas generation will grow at a rate of approximately 2.7% per year between 2012 and 2040, which will account for nearly 30% of the total worldwide energy generation by 2040. The deployment of CCUS in this sector will help in creating a viable pathway for a sustainable environment.

Chlor-alkali products, namely, chlorine, caustic soda, and soda ash are utilized in various industries. Chlorine and caustic soda are produced through the electrolysis of brine, and soda ash is produced through the Solvay process. These three products are used as raw materials in various industries; chlorine is a vital building block and more than 60% industrial chemicals require it in some form or other in production processes. Caustic soda finds applications in personal care products such as soaps and detergents. Soda ash is used in the glass industry, chemicals, and for water treatment. Some applications such as water treatment, food, and pulp & paper are common in all the three chlor-alkali products

The Chlor-Alkali market is segmented on the basis of type as Chlorine, Caustic Soda, Soda Ash, and others. Chlorine plays an important role in various chemical industries. It is a building block in chemistry because of its reactivity and bonding characteristics. It is produced by electrolysis, majorly with the use of the membrane cell technology. Some of the manufacturers use diaphragm technology and mercury cell technology. Chlorine reacts with almost all elements, except lighter noble gases. It is a good disinfectant and bleaching agent. Chlorine applications includes EDC/PVC, organic chemicals, inorganic chemicals, isocyanates, chlorinated intermediates, propylene oxide, pulp & paper, C1/C2/ aromatics, water treatment, and others.

Olin Corporation manufactures chemicals and ammunition. Its business is divided into three segments, Chlor Alkali Products and Vinyls, Epoxy (epoxy materials and precursors), and Winchester (arms and ammunition). Its Chlor Alkali Products include chlorine and caustic soda, methyl chloride, methylene chloride, ethylene dichloride & vinyl chloride monomer, chloroform, hydrochloric acid, simultaneously with 1 ton perchloroethylene, carbon tetrachloride, trichloroethylene, bleach products, hydrogen, and potassium hydroxide. The Chlor Alkali and Epoxy businesses were added to the company as a spin-off from The Dow Chemical Company in 2015. The company produces chlorine, caustic soda, and hydrogen through the electrolysis of salt, also known as Electrochemical Unit (ECU). These products are produced simultaneously in the proportion of 1 ton of chlorine to 1.1 tons of caustic soda and 0.03 tons of hydrogen. The company offers these chlor-alkali products for polyvinylchloride (PVC), water treatment, alumina, pulp & paper, detergents & soaps, and other applications. It has seven production facilities for chlorine and caustic soda in the US and Canada. It has a strong presence in North America and also offers its products across Europe, the Asia Pacific, and Latin America.

The flexible segment is projected to be the fastest-growing segment in the electrical conduit market. This electrical conduit is lightweight, typically less expensive than other options, and versatile & easy to install. Flexible electrical conduit is much easier to work with than rigid metal or plastic conduit. This is because there is no bending involved. However, flexible electrical conduit will not offer quite as much protection as rigid electrical conduit. It is flexible and can snake through walls and other structures. This electrical conduit is used owing to its advantages such as lightweight conduit, typically less expensive than other options, and versatile & easy to install.
